What color is EBA18A?

The RGB color code for color number #EBA18A is RGB(235, 161, 138). In the RGB color model, #EBA18A has a red value of 235, a green value of 161, and a blue value of 138.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 31.5% magenta, 41.3% yellow, and 7.8%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 14.2° (degrees), 70.8 % saturation, and 73.1 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#EBA18A has a hue of 14.2° (degrees), 41.3 % saturation and 92.2 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of #EBA18A? (For interior and product design)

EBA18A has an LRV of nearly 45.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.

Is #EBA18A Readable? WCAG Contrast Checker (For digital design)

Check if the color EBA18A meets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) standards, minimum contrast ratio standards between text and background colors. The W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) provides global standards for readable web content.

WCAG Recommendations - Large Text: above 18pt or 14pt bold. Normal Text: below 18pt or 14pt bold.

  • Minimum contrast ratio (AA): 4.5 for normal text and 3 for large text.
  • Enhanced contrast ratio (AAA): 7 for normal text and 4.5 for large text.

Complementary / Opposite Color

Complementary colors are pairs of colors which, when combined or mixed, cancel each other out (lose hue) by producing a grayscale color like white or black. When placed next to each other, they create the strongest contrast for those two colors. Complementary colors also called opposite colors. Complementary color schemes are created using two opposite colors on the color wheel. The examples are red–cyan, green–magenta, and blue–yellow.
